📜 All Formula data fields for Guan Xin Jing Tablet
📜 Names
Pinyin Name
Guan Xin Jing Pian
中文名 (Chinese)
冠心静片
English Name
Guan Xin Jing Tablet
💊 Form & Use
Type (类别)
和血药
Category
Chinese patent medicines
Dosage Form
片剂 (Tablet)
Administration
Oral
Source / 出处
ETCM
🌿 Composition
Herbs (中文)
三七, 丹参, 人参, 冰片, 川芎, 玉竹, 红花, 苏合香, 赤芍
Herbs (Pinyin)
San Qi, Dan Shen, Ren Shen, Bing Pian, Chuan Qiong, Yu Zhu, Hong Hua, Su He Xiang, Chi Shao
🩺 Syndromes & Indications
Syndromes (中文)
气虚血瘀证; 心气虚血瘀证
Syndromes (English)
Syndrome of blood stasis due to qi deficiency; Syndrome of blood stasis due to heart qi deficiency
Indications (中文)
胸痹, 心悸, 真心痛
Indications (English)
Palpitations, Chest painful impediment, True heart pain
